T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 6 2 PRESCRIBED CAPITAL REQUIREMENT (“PCR”) AND MINIMUM CAPITAL REQUIREMENT (“MCR”) 2.1 The Capital Adequacy Ratio (“CAR”) and Fund Solvency Ratio (“FSR”) remain relevant under RBC 2, meaning that insurers will be asked to compute these two ratios. The CAR continues to be the ratio of Financial Resources (“FR”) / Total Risk Requirements (“TRR”) at the company level. In the case of the FSR, it will be the ratio of FR / TRR at the adjusted fund level, instead of the insurance fund level (see the table below). Notwithstanding that, insurers are still required to ensure that there are sufficient assets to meet liabilities at insurance fund level. Adjusted fund level is for the sole purpose of monitoring solvency requirement. Current Fund Levels under RBC Adjusted Fund Levels under RBC 2 • Singapore Insurance Fund (“SIF”) – Participating (“Par”) • SIF Non-Par • SIF – Investment-linked (“Linked”) • Offshore Insurance Fund (“OIF”) – Par • OIF – Non-Par • OIF – Linked • SIF – General • OIF – General • SIF – Par • SIF – Others • OIF – Par • OIF – Others Solvency Intervention Levels 2.2 MAS will set two transparent triggers for supervisory intervention when assessing the capital adequacy3 of an insurer, at both the company and adjusted fund level: (a) PCR, which is the higher supervisory intervention level at which the insurer is required to hold sufficient FR to meet the TRR which correspond to a Value-atRisk (“VaR”) of 99.5%4 confidence level over a one-year period. Section 4 of this document provides details on the risk requirements5 (calibrated at 99.5% VaR), whilst Section 5 provides details on how FR is computed; and
3 Similar to exisiting requirements under regulation 4 of the Insurance (Valuation and Capital) Regulations 2004, financial resources of the insurer at a company level shall also not be less than $5million at all times. 4 The 99.5% confidence level corresponds to an implied credit rating of at least an investment grade, and many insurance regulators of major jurisdictions have targeted this level in setting their regulatory capital requirements, including the global insurance capital standards being developed currently. 5 The relevant risk requirements, and the definitions of the risks under RBC 2 can be found in Appendix 1.
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 7 (b) MCR, which is the lower supervisory intervention level at which the insurer is required to hold sufficient FR to meet the TRR which correspond to a VaR of 90%6 confidence level over a one-year period. MCR is calibrated as 50% of the PCR. 2.3 An insurer would have met the PCR at the company and adjusted fund level when its CAR and FSR are at least 100% respectively. If the insurer does not meet the PCR, that is, the CAR or FSR falls below 100%, the insurer will need to submit to MAS a plan and restore its capital position within a timeframe agreed with MAS. During periods of exceptional market stresses, MAS has the discretion to allow insurers more time to restore their capital positions to PCR level. 2.4 If an insurer does not meet the MCR, that is, the CAR or FSR falls below 50%, MAS may require the insurer to stop new business, withdraw the insurer’s licence, or adopt any regulatory measure deemed necessary and in accordance with its mandate. 2.5 Given that RBC 2 is a more comprehensive and risk-sensitive framework than the current RBC, any capital add-ons for supervisory purposes is expected to occur under relatively more limited circumstances. As set out in the Third Consultation Paper, such circumstances may include, but not limited to: (a) Where the risk profile of the insurer is higher than the industry level that has been used in the calibration of the risk requirements under RBC 2; (b) To account for higher operational risks such as when an insurer exhibits severe operational control deficiencies and the prescribed formula does not adequately buffer for the increased operational risks; (c) To account for deficiencies in the insurer’s controls and processes which may lead to gross under-estimation of policy liabilities or capital positions, as well as inaccurate financial figures; (d) To account for deficiencies in the insurer’s own economic capital model; and (e) To account for offshore risks if it is assessed that a reinsurer did not manage these risks adequately. 2.6 The high impact surcharge will still be relevant for systemically relevant insurers, but the capital add-on is not expected to be significant. 2.7 Supervisory capital add-ons and high impact surcharge, where applicable, will effectively bring the higher supervisory solvency intervention level to a level higher than the PCR which is calibrated at VaR 99.5%. T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 8 will have to hold a CAR of at least 130%. If the insurer does not meet 130%, it would trigger supervisory actions equivalent to those of not meeting the PCR (i.e. CAR of at least 100%). 2.8 Notwithstanding supervisory capital add-ons and surcharges, the onus is on insurers to determine the buffer to hold above the PCR in accordance with factors such as internal economic capital computations and market expectations, including that of rating agencies and analysts.
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 9 3 VALUATION OF ASSETS AND LIABILITIES 3.1 Unless otherwise specified in this document, valuation of all assets and liabilities should be done in accordance with the Insurance (Valuation and Capital) Regulations 20047 for the purpose of the parallel run. Discounting Approach Discounting of life business 3.2 A three-segment approach is used in deriving the risk-free yield curve for discounting the liability cash flows under RBC 2: (a) Segment 1: Liquid segment based on market information on government bonds; (b) Segment 2: Extrapolation between first and third segment, using Smith-Wilson method 8 to extrapolate between the last liquid point (“LLP”) to the commencement of Segment 3; (c) Segment 3: Convergence to the Ultimate Forward Rate (“UFR”). 3.3 The UFR will be determined as the sum of expected real interest rate and expected inflation rate. This is aligned with the approach taken by the International Association of Insurance Supervisors (“IAIS”) on the design of the global insurance capital standard (“ICS”). Under ICS, the UFR (also known as the Long-Term Forward Rate in ICS) is determined as the

T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 10 sum of the expected real interest rate and the expected inflation rate, which is based on central bank inflation targets9 . 3.4 For the purpose of the parallel run, the UFR for SGD and USD denominated liabilities remains at 3.8%10 . MAS has adopted the proposed LLP and convergence period under ICS for the purpose of RBC 2 (the LLP is known as Last Observed Term in ICS). The LLPs for SGD and USD denominated liabilities remain unchanged at 20 years and 30 years respectively. The convergence point remains as 60 years for both currencies. 3.5 MAS has derived the spot risk-free discount rates to be used for discounting SGD and USD denominated liabilities and has provided the rates in the Discount Rate Workbook to insurers. MAS has derived the yield curves for these two currencies as this covers more than 99% of the life insurers’ liabilities in aggregate. 3.6 For liabilities in other currencies, the workbook provided can be used or modified to derive the spot risk-free discount rates. Please refer to the Last Observed Term, convergence period and Long-Term Forward Rate for the relevant currency as specified in the ICS 2018 Field Testing Technical Specifications11 for the LLP, convergence period and UFR respectively. The workbook will allow insurers to generate the spot risk-free discount rates for LLPs of 20 and 30 years12 once parameters such as spot risk-free rates in Segment 1, UFR, and speed of convergence of forward rates to UFR (which is determined by the alpha parameter13) are entered into the workbook. The workbook uses the Smith-Wilson method to extrapolate discount rates in Segment 2 of the yield curve. 3.7 Insurers that write direct life business and/or life reinsurance business are allowed to apply adjustments to the above derived risk-free discount rates when discounting the liability cash flows, subject to certain conditions being met. Treatment of Negative Reserves for Valuation 3.9 Insurers should not value the liability in respect of any policy to be less than zero, unless there are monies due to the insurer when the policy is terminated on valuation date (e.g. surrender penalty), in which event the value of the liability in respect of that policy may be negative to the extent of the amount due to the insurer. Part of the negative reserves will be recognised however as positive regulatory adjustment to the available capital. This will be discussed under Section 5. Valuation of Long-term Medical Policies 3.10 Insurers are required to hold policy liabilities for long-term medical policies as the sum of the following components: a) An amount which is adequate to cover the cost of future expected claims and expense outgo, allowing for future expected premiums and investment income, including provision for adverse deviation (“PAD”). The term of projection would depend on the contract boundary definition set out below; and b) An amount which is adequate to cover the cost of claims which has already been incurred prior to the valuation date i.e. claims liabilities. This comprises reported but not settled (“RBNS”) claims and incurred but not reported (“IBNR”) claims. Contract Boundary Considerations 3.11 MAS has previously noted differences in insurers’ valuation methodology14 for longterm medical policies. MAS has thus introduced the definition of contract boundary for such policies to ensure consistency in the valuation approach and to avoid undue recognition of large amount of negative reserves arising from these policies (given that the premium rates are adjustable). Hence, the valuation of long-term medical policies should consider the boundaries of the contract, to be determined as follows: a) Cash flows are within the boundary of the insurance contract if they arise from rights and obligations that exist during the period in which the insurer has a substantive obligation to provide the policyholder with the contracted insurance coverage or other services. A substantive obligation ends when the following criteria are satisfied:

T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 12 (i) the insurer has the unconstrained practical ability to reassess the risks of the contract or a portfolio of contracts and, as a result, can set a price or level of benefits that fully reflects the reassessed risk of that portfolio; and (ii) the pricing of premiums for the coverage up to the date when risks are reassessed, do not reflect risks related to periods beyond the reassessment date. b) When assessing whether the insurer has the practical ability to set a price that fully reflects the risks in the contract or portfolio, it is to consider all the risks that it would normally consider when underwriting equivalent contracts on the renewal date for the remaining coverage. c) Insurers should disclose its selection of contract boundary, including the justification, in the Questionnaire. In particular, the insurer should justify its practical ability to reassess the risks and as a result, set a price or level of benefits that fully reflect the reassessed risks of the portfolio of contracts. Going forward, such disclosure will be required in the actuarial investigation report. d) The insurer should regularly assess if there is any change in circumstances that may affect its practical ability to reprice (per paragraph 3.11(a)(i)). For instance, if the insurer foresees restrictions to such practical ability, it should then value the liabilities of the portfolio based on a longer term projection (i.e. up to the natural expiry of the policies within the portfolio). 3.12 For medical riders attached to long-term medical policies, the contract boundary should be determined based on the considerations in paragraph 3.11. However, the contract boundary of the riders should not be longer than that of the main plan’s. 3.13 The computation of C1 risk requirements for long-term medical policies is to follow the same contract boundary as that pre-determined for the liability valuation. Homogeneous Risk Grouping 4.3 Insurers are allowed to group policies into homogeneous risk groups (“HRG”s) for the purpose of applying the C1 insurance risk stresses under RBC 2, instead of performing the stresses at each policy level. For this purpose, an HRG consists of portfolios of products (or policies) with similar risk characteristics. 4.4 Insurers should consider the appropriate manner to group policies into homogeneous risks groups for the purpose of calculating the various C1 risk charges. The insurers should exercise prudence on the granularity of policy groupings. The more homogeneous the policy groupings, the lesser the extent of off-setting effects between policies for any particular risk. In grouping the policies or products into HRGs, the insurers carefully consider at least the following (non-exhaustive) items: • Underwriting policy • Risk profile of policyholders • Product features, in particular guarantees • Future management actions 4.5 Products that are more susceptible to mortality risks (e.g. products with high death benefits) should be grouped separately from those which are more prone to longevity risks (e.g. annuities, long-term care products, products with high survival benefits).
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 17 4.6 Policies should be grouped according to their major product features that may lead to similar lapse behaviour and risks within the group. For instance, products with more guarantees may be at a greater risk of having lower than expected lapse rates, while products with high surrender benefits may face greater risk when there are higher than expected lapse rates. 4.7 Policies in the Participating Funds (or Sub-Funds) should be grouped according to the risk sharing rules allowed by the insurers’ internal participating fund governance policy for the various C1 insurance risks. 4.8 For avoidance of doubt, the valuation of liability is required to be performed at each policy level. The grouping of policies into HRGs is only for the application of various C1 risk stresses and hence for the sole purpose of computation of C1 risk requirements. 4.9 Insurers should disclose its basis for grouping policies into HRGs and the justification of the appropriateness in the Questionnaire. Property Investment Risk Requirement To calculate the property investment risk requirement, insurers are to apply: 30% risk charge to the current market value of each property exposure for immovable property, for both investment and self-occupied purpose; or Look-through approach (as described for CIS) for collective real estate investment vehicles. Where the insurer chooses not to or is unable to adopt a look-through approach, a risk charge of 50% on the value of the CIS will apply. The property investment risk requirement is then taken to be the aggregate of the calculations for all property exposures. Additional Notes: Note 21: Investments in companies that are engaged in real estate management or real estate project development or similar activities should be treated as equity investments. T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 31 Ageing of Outstanding Premium 4.18 When computing the counterparty default risk requirements for outstanding premium, insurers are to use billable30 date as the start date for ageing of outstanding premium for annual and multi-year policies of direct life and general insurance business. 4.19 ”Billable date” refers to the date which part or all of each premium can first be billed without taking into consideration any credit period given. For example, in the case of an annual paying policy with an inception date of 1.1.2018, the premium will be considered billable on 1.1.2018, 1.1.2019 etc. regardless of whether insurers may send the bill to policyholders earlier or later. Similarly, for a monthly paying policy with an inception date of 1.1.2018, the premium will be considered billable on 1.1.2018, 1.2.2018, 1.3.2018 etc. 4.20 For avoidance of doubt, there is no change to the current approach of ageing of outstanding premium for reinsurance business (i.e. ageing starts from accrual date for reinsurance business), except for facultative reinsurance business, where ageing will be on a billable date basis. Reinsurance Adjustment 5.8 The reinsurance adjustment will be calculated as: A x B, where A= Reinsurance reduction, which is broadly the reduction in the value of liabilities due to reinsurance ceded to the reinsurance counterparty. This amount can be reduced by reinsurance deposits and collateral arrangements, trust arrangements and the use of Letter of Credit; B= The counterparty default risk factor which depends on the credit rating of the reinsurer 5.9 When performing the parallel run for the year ending 31 December 2018, insurers should assume that the following proposals relating to the computation of reinsurance adjustment will be effected immediately: a) To remove the recognition of the reinsurance arrangement between a Head Office and its branch in Singapore. This means there should not be any reinsurance reduction (when valuing the insurers’ liabilities) and no reinsurance adjustment resulting from these arrangements between branch and Head Office37;

Adjustment for Asset Concentration (Former C3 Requirements) 5.15 Under RBC 2, C3 requirements under the current RBC would instead be treated as a deduction from the Financial Resources i.e. the asset holdings which exceed the prescribed concentration limits (as set out in Table 14 of the Sixth Schedule in Insurance (Valuation and Capital) Regulations 2004) is to be deducted from the Financial Resources. The assets that are deducted from Financial Resources will not be subject to further risk requirements. 5.16 Insurers should calculate the amounts of assets above the prescribed concentration limits based on the adjusted fund levels as described in Section 2 of this document. 5.17 For avoidance of doubt, the OIF of licensed reinsurance branches and locally incorporated reinsurers that are not headquartered in Singapore, will not be subject to this treatment of asset concentration. T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 45 6.11 The MA for a particular MA portfolio is determined as the average yield of the assets backing the liabilities for guaranteed benefits over the average risk-free liability yield49, less the spreads for default and downgrade. The methodology for determining the costs of default and downgrade can be found in Appendix 18. The calculation of the MA is automated in the MA Workbook. The MA will be floored at the level of IP50 that would have been applicable to the MA portfolio51 . More details on the operation of the floor is provided in Appendix 16. Illiquidity Premium 6.12 The IP operates in a similar manner as MA, and is intended to be applied to products that have a lower level of cash flow predictability than the MA, or where the insurer is unable or unwilling to meet the more extensive requirements under the MA. The framework for the IP is provided in Appendix 19, with some updates to the parameters. 6.13 MAS has calibrated the IP based on a Reference Portfolio of SGD- and USDdenominated bonds of at least investment grade 52 held by the industry 53 in the participating fund and non-participating fund. For the purpose of the parallel run, the IP for the Reference Portfolio is maintained at 55 bps, and applies to both Qualifying Debt Securities and Other Debt Securities54. This revised calibration of the IP was based on 50% of the Reference Spread, and is further explained in Appendix 20. 6.14 The actual IP to be applied by the insurer will depend on the amount of Qualifying Debt Securities and Other Debt Securities the insurer has. T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 54 Appendix 1 TYPE OF RISK REQUIREMENTS AND DESCRIPTION OF RISKS Diagram 1: Risk Modules under RBC 2 Type of risk requirements Description of risk Mortality risk Mortality risk is the risk associated with the variability in liability cash flows due to the incidence of death. Longevity risk Longevity risk is the risk associated with the variability in liability cash flows due to increasing life expectancy. Disability risk Disability risk is the risk associated with the variability in liability cash flows due to the incidence of policyholder’s disability claims, as well as recovery or termination rates. Dread disease risk Dread disease risk is the risk associated with the variability in liability cash flows due to the incidence of dread disease claims, as well as recovery or termination rates. Other insured events (A&H) risk Other insured events (A&H) risk is the risk associated with the variability in liability cash flows due to the incidence of
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 55 accident and health claims as well as recovery or termination rates. Expense risk Expense risk is the risk associated with the variability in liability cash flows due to the incidence of expenses incurred. Lapse risk Lapse risk is the risk associated with the variability in liability cash flows due to the incidence of lapses (including forfeitures, surrenders etc) by policyholders. Includes consideration of a mass lapse event. Conversion of options risk Conversion of options risk is the risk associated with the variability in liability cash flows due to the incidence of policyholders exercising available options (for example, convertible term). Life insurance catastrophe risk Life insurance catastrophe risk stems from extreme or irregular events which effects are not sufficiently captured in the other C1 requirements. Premium liability risk Premium liability risk is associated with future claims and is the risk that the amount set aside for claims and expenses against unearned premiums will prove inadequate. Claims liability risk Claims liability risk is associated with incurred claims, i.e. existing claims, and is the risk that the amount set aside for claims that have already occurred will prove inadequate. General insurance catastrophe risk General insurance catastrophe risk stems from extreme or irregular events which effects are not sufficiently captured in requirements for premium liability risk and claim liability risk. Equity investment risk Equity investment risk is the risk of economic loss due to changes in the price of equity exposures. Interest rate mismatch risk Interest rate mismatch risk is the risk arising from changes in market interest rates, which affect the prices of debt securities and policy liabilities where the valuation of policy liabilities requires discounting of future policy liability cash flows using the market yield of the relevant yield curve. Credit spread risk Credit spread risk is the risk of change in value due to movements in the market price of credit risk. This includes both the credit default as well as credit spread widening risk.
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 56 Property investment risk Property risk is the risk of economic loss due to changes in the price of property exposures. Foreign currency mismatch risk Foreign currency mismatch risk is the risk of economic loss due to adverse movements in the value of foreign currencies against the Singapore dollar. Counterparty default risk Counterparty default risk is the risk of economic loss due to unexpected default of the counterparties and debtors of insurers. Miscellaneous risk Miscellaneous risk covers risk of loss in value for fixed assets and assets that are non-financial instruments. It excludes: Risks that have been covered in the other C2 risk requirements Non-standard instruments as described under paragraph 1(5) of the Fourth Schedule of the Insurance (Valuation and Capital) Regulations 2004, which would be retained under RBC 2 Operational risk Operational risk refers to the risk of loss arising from complex operations, inadequate internal controls, processes and information systems, organisational changes, fraud or human errors, (or unforeseen catastrophes including terrorist attacks).

T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 66 Appendix 5 APPROACHES FOR RECOGNISING INSURER’S INTERNAL CREDIT RATING MODEL AND PROCESS FOR UNRATED CORPORATE BONDS 1 Singapore insurers generally hold a sizeable proportion69 of long-dated unrated bonds to match long-term liabilities, in view of a domestic market shortage of long-dated government and rated corporate bonds. A significant proportion of these bonds are issued by Singapore statutory boards. The rest of the unrated bond holdings are mostly issued by financially strong corporates in Singapore that did not seek a rating. The credit spread shock for unrated bonds70 is by default set as the average of the credit spread shock for “BB” and “BBB” rated bonds71 . 2 During the RBC 2 consultation phase, the industry had suggested that MAS specify the criteria for an admissible internal credit rating model. Insurers must satisfy these criteria before they are allowed to use the internal credit rating derived from such a model to read off the corresponding prescribed credit spread risk shock for unrated bonds. MAS has subsequently consulted on a set of criteria in the 2016. 3 Since then, MAS has been engaging insurers who have indicated interest in getting their internal credit rating process recognised for unrated bonds, to better understand their rating process and the level of expertise and oversight. This is with a view to better calibrate the proposal to recognise the insurers’ internal credit rating process for unrated bonds. 4 Under RBC 2, two approaches will be allowed, based on whether an insurer is applying for recognition of (1) an internal credit rating model or (2) an internal credit rating process. The internal credit rating derived under either approach are then applied to the RBC2 prescribed credit spread shocks for credit spread risk requirement computation. For avoidance of doubt, for bonds issued by Singapore statutory boards and recognised multilateral agencies, the credit spread to be applied would still be 50% of that proposed for a “AAA”- rated corporate bond, unless the insurer is of the view that it would not be prudent to do so.

T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 75 Appendix 7 RECOGNITION OF EXTERNAL CREDIT ASSESSMENT INSTITUTIONS ("ECAI”) 1 MAS may recognise an ECAI if MAS – (a) is satisfied that the ECAI meets the recognition criteria81 set out under paragraph 7.3.53 of MAS Notice 63782; and (b) has received a letter of support from an licensed insurer stating that it intends to use the external credit assessments of that ECAI for the purposes of calculating regulatory capital requirements under RBC2. 2 The recognition of an ECAI by MAS shall be for the sole purpose of calculating regulatory capital requirements by an insurer under RBC 2, and shall not be taken as regulation of the ECAI or licensing or approval of the ECAI to do business in Singapore. 3 MAS may revoke its recognition of an ECAI if the ECAI no longer meets the criteria set out in MAS Notice 637. 4 The recognition criteria listed in MAS Notice 637 broadly covers: i. Objectivity: The methodology for assigning credit assessments of a recognised ECAI shall be rigorous, systematic and subject to validation based on historical experience. Credit assessments shall be subject to ongoing review and responsive to changes in financial condition of the entity assessed. An assessment methodology for each market segment, including rigorous backtesting, shall have been established for at least one year, and preferably at least three years. ii. Independence: A recognised ECAI should not be subject to economic, political and any other pressures that may influence its credit assessments. The credit assessment process should be as free as possible from any constraints which could arise in situations where the composition of the board of directors or the shareholder structure of the ECAI may be seen as creating a conflict of interest.
81 MAS Notice 637 Part VII Division 3 Sub-division 5 82 Although reference has been made here to the relevant provisions under MAS Notice 637 for the purpose of this parallel run technical specifications, the applicable requirements would be set out in the relevant legislation for RBC 2.
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 76 iii. International Access and Transparency: The individual credit assessments of a recognised ECAI, the key elements underlying the assessments and whether the issuer participated in the assessment process shall be publicly available on a non-selective basis, unless they are private assessments. In addition, the general procedures, methodologies and assumptions for arriving at assessments used by a recognised ECAI shall be publicly disclosed. iv. Disclosure: A recognised ECAI should publicly disclose its code of conduct, the general nature of its compensation arrangements with assessed entities, its assessment methodologies (including the definition of default, the time horizon and the meaning of each credit assessment), the actual default rates experienced in each credit assessment category, and the transitions of the assessments, for example, the likelihood of “AA” ratings becoming “A” over time. v. Resources: A recognised ECAI should have sufficient resources to carry out credit assessments properly. These resources should allow for sufficient ongoing contact with senior and operational levels within the entities assessed in order to add value to the credit assessments. vi. Credibility: To some extent, credibility is derived from the criteria above. In addition, the reliance on an ECAI’s external credit assessments by independent parties (e.g. investors, insurers, trading partners) would be evidence of the credibility of the assessments of the ECAI. The credibility of an ECAI is also underpinned by the existence of internal procedures to prevent the misuse of confidential information. 4 The list of recognised ECAIs for licensed insurers is currently set out in Table 1 of the Sixth Schedule in Insurance (Valuation and Capital) Regulations 2004, and this list will remain under RBC 2.

T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 87 Appendix 11 MINIMUM REQUIREMENTS FOR PAID-UP ORDINARY SHARES A paid-up ordinary share87 of the insurer shall not qualify for inclusion as CET1 Capital unless – (a) the ordinary share represents the most subordinated claim in liquidation; (b) the entitlement of ordinary shareholders to a claim on the residual assets is proportional to their share of issued share capital, after all senior claims have been repaid in liquidation. In this regard, the claims of such holders are unlimited and variable (i.e. not fixed or capped); (c) the amount paid-up by ordinary shareholders is perpetual and is not repaid outside of liquidation. This excludes discretionary repurchases by the insurer or other means of reducing capital in a discretionary manner that is allowable under written law; (d) the insurer does not create an expectation at issuance that the ordinary shares will be bought back, redeemed or cancelled, nor do the contractual terms provide any feature that might give rise to such an expectation; (e) distributions in respect of ordinary shares (“distributions”) are only paid by the insurer to the extent that the insurer has profits distributable under written law. The level of distributions is not tied or linked to the amount paid-up at issuance, and is not subject to a contractual cap, except to the extent that the insurer is unable to pay distributions that exceed the level of profits distributable under written law; (f) there are no circumstances under which distributions are obligatory and the nonpayment of distributions is not an event of default; (g) distributions are only paid after all legal and contractual obligations have been met, and after payments on AT1 capital instruments and Tier 2 capital instruments have been made. In this regard, there are no preferential distributions, including in respect of other CET1 capital;
87 In the case where the insurer issues non-voting ordinary shares as part of CET1 Capital, the non-voting ordinary shares shall be identical to the voting ordinary shares of the insurer in all respects, except the absence of voting rights.
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 88 (h) the ordinary share takes the first and proportionately greatest share of any losses as they occur 88 . In this regard, it absorbs losses on a going concern basis proportionately and pari passu with all other CET1 capital instruments; (i) the amount paid-up by ordinary shareholders is recognised as equity and not a liability, for the purposes of determining balance sheet insolvency; (j) the amount paid-up by ordinary shareholders is classified as equity under the Accounting Standards; (k) the ordinary share is directly issued and fully paid-up in cash, and purchase of the ordinary share is not directly or indirectly funded by the insurer; (l) the amount paid-up by ordinary shareholders is not secured or covered by a guarantee of the insurer or any of its related corporations or other affiliates. In addition, the ordinary share is not subject to any other arrangement that legally or economically enhances the seniority of the claim; (m) the ordinary share is issued with the approval of the ordinary shareholders. The approval is either given directly by the ordinary shareholders or, if permitted by written law, given by the board of the insurer or by other persons duly authorised by the ordinary shareholders; and (n) the ordinary share is clearly and separately disclosed on the insurer’s balance sheet.

T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 107 Appendix 18 METHODOLOGY FOR DETERMINING COSTS OF DEFAULT AND DOWNGRADE Cost of Default Cost of Downgrade The cost of downgrade is determined as the present value of the probability weighted average increase in spreads arising from the investment grade bond being downgraded to below investment grade in future years. Methodology For a given bond price, tenure and credit rating, 𝑃𝑟𝑖𝑐𝑒 @ 𝑌𝑇𝑀 = ∑𝐷𝑖𝑠𝑐𝐹𝑎𝑐𝑡𝑜𝑟(𝑡)𝐶𝑎𝑠ℎ𝐹𝑙𝑜𝑤(𝑡) 𝑛 1 𝑃𝑟𝑖𝑐𝑒 @ 𝐴𝑑𝑗𝑌𝑇𝑀 = ∑𝐷𝑖𝑠𝑐𝐹𝑎𝑐𝑡𝑜𝑟(𝑡)𝑃𝑟𝑜𝑏𝑃𝑎𝑦𝑜𝑢𝑡(𝑡)𝐶𝑎𝑠ℎ𝐹𝑙𝑜𝑤(𝑡) 𝑛 1 𝑃𝑟𝑜𝑏𝑃𝑎𝑦𝑜𝑢𝑡(𝑡) = ∑𝑃𝑟𝑜𝑏(𝑡, 𝐶𝑟𝑒𝑑𝑖𝑡 𝑅𝑎𝑡𝑖𝑛𝑔)𝑜𝑣𝑒𝑟 𝑎𝑙𝑙 𝑛𝑜𝑛 − 𝑑𝑒𝑓𝑎𝑢𝑙𝑡 𝑟𝑎𝑡𝑖𝑛𝑔 Prob(t, Credit Rating) = probability of being in Credit Rating at time t. Prob(t, Credit Rating) is built up recursively from time 1 to t, using conditional probabilities derived from ratings transition matrix. (a) CashFlow(t) = Coupon at time (t) (b) Cashflow(n) = Proceed at time of maturity (c) ProbPayout(t) = Probability of payout at time(t), given the current credit rating and loss given default of x%. Using a ratings transition matrix, it is possible to determine the probability that the bond will not default in every future year up to maturity. (d) YTM = Current yield to maturity of bond (e) AdjYTM = Adjusted yield to maturity after taking into account the probability of payout in future years. Due to defaults, AdjYTM < YTM (f) Cost of Default = YTM - AdjYTM The cost of default can be determined based on representative maturities, coupons, and yield observed in the market. A 20% loading is applied to account for unexpected defaults beyond that observed historically
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 108 Appendix 19 FRAMEWORK FOR IP Updates have been made to the framework for IP from the 2018 impact study, and are shown as red underlined text. Please refer to Appendix 20 for more information on how the k-factor is determined. Eligibility For direct life business, all SGD- and USD- denominated products classified as Whole Life, Endowment, or Annuity in Form 14 are eligible. ILPs are not eligible. For life reinsurance business, the IP should only be applied to reinsurance arrangements that exhibit similar characteristics as the direct life insurance products (e.g. Whole Life, Endowment and Annuity Products) that qualify for IP (see Note 3 of paragraph 6.3). Illiquidity Premium (“IP”) To be specified as 50% of the Reference Spread, subject to a possible cap. Determination of Reference Spread The Reference Spread (“RS”) will be determined based on the average credit spread of a notional Reference Portfolio of assets. It consists of the spread from the Reference Portfolio less costs associated with credit risks i.e. cost of default, and floored at zero. The cost of default is consistent with those used in the calibration of the MA. RS = Average Corporate Spread from Reference Portfolio, adjusted for Cost of Default The Reference Portfolio is determined based on the holding pattern of investment grade bonds held by industry. To smooth the yearly fluctuations, the Reference Portfolio may take into account bond compositions over the past years. The use of a shorter period would give more weight to recent economic environment, whilst a longer period would produce a more stable IP. The Reference Portfolio can be updated at appropriate frequency106, to ensure that it remains relevant. The frequency
106 At a start, MAS expects to review the Reference Portfolio at least annually, and if there are material changes, MAS will update the Reference Portfolio and the Reference Spread accordingly.
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 109 chosen should balance the objectives of risk responsiveness and the effort required to update the Reference Portfolio. Impact of IP on Valuation Framework IP will be the spread added to the valuation discount rate. The IP will apply uniformly in full up to the LLP. Additional options on the treatment of the IP after the LLP will be investigated during the parallel run for year ended 31 December 2018. These are set out in Section 7. The IP will not be applicable to products where the MA is applied.
TECHNICAL SPECIFICATIONS FOR RBC 2 6 MAY 2019 MONETARY AUTHORITY OF SINGAPORE 110 Appendix 20 CALIBRATION OF THE IP AND DERIVATION OF THE FUND LEVEL IP 1 To make the calibration of IP more meaningful, MAS collected data from life insurers listed in Appendix 15, which were offering participating and non-participating products, in June 2016. Information was collected, amongst others, on the yields on existing corporate bonds, which were of investment grade and above (including bonds issued by multilateral agencies and Singapore statutory boards) denominated in SGD and USD. 2 The Reference Portfolio was based on the collective portfolio of bonds which were of investment grade and above, held at the industry level, as provided by the insurers listed in Appendix 15. 3 The IP for the Reference Portfolio was determined as k% of the Reference Spread. The Reference Spread is the average credit spread (over the corresponding yield of government securities of a matching duration) of the Reference Portfolio after deducting the spread for default107, and floored at zero. Haircuts were subsequently applied to account for the following: (a) Basis risk arising from the difference between the actual compositions of investment grade bonds held by any insurer and the Reference Portfolio; and (b) Allowance for a higher level of liquidity in products eligible for the IP (as compared to MA). 4 For the purpose of the parallel run, the k-factor is 50%. 5 The Reference Spread for corporate bonds held in the participating and nonparticipating funds combined was determined to be 110 bps. 6 The IP for the Reference Portfolio is hence 50% * 110 = 55 bps. 7 The final fund level IP to be applied by insurer should be calculated by the insurer based on the SAA extracted from the latest board-approved investment policy.
